  • @ZombieUppercut The owners manual only shows the Gross weight, which is 4100 pounds. You're looking for curb weight. The gross weight it with the car filled to it's maximum capacity. (4 people in the car, full trunk, and full tank of gas). The cars weight itself is the curb weight. No passengers, empty trunk, no gas. And when you talk about racing (where it really matters) the car will most likely be empty except for the driver. So it's closer to the curb weight.

  • @datpimpinboy No, you do have to rev-match every time you make any shift. Otherwise you add wear to the clutch. Rev-matching isn't limited to a blip on a downshift. It doesn't even necessarily require adding gas. It is simply making sure that when you engage the clutch to the flywheel, your rpms are exact or close to exact as possible. Therefore prolonging the life of your clutch and making the ride seamless.

  • @datpimpinboy I'm not sure what you aren't understanding by my comment so I'll try to be even more clear. When you upshift, and say you wait too long to complete the shift, or shift to fast, what happens? Your car jerks a little, or a lot depending on how far off your rpms are between your engine and tranny. The term rev match simply means matching the transmission speed to the speed of the engine. Like I said before, it doesn't ONLY refer to a blip of gas on a downshift. Does that make sense?

  • @datpimpinboy Except that you are supposed to match rpms. Simply disengaging the clutch, shifting gear, then re-engaging the clutch in a second won't necessarily make a difference. It all depends on how fast your car's rpms drop after clutch in. Like if your cars revs drop fast you'll probably either have to drop the clutch or give it gas to get up to the right engine speed for the next gear. And if your revs drop too slow you'll have to pause on your shift. Either way, it is all rev-matching.
